body {
  margin:10;
  padding:0;
  border:0;
  background:#ffffff; 
  font-family:arial, verdana, sans-serif; 
  font-size:70%;
  text-align:left;  }

#container {
  font-family: arial, sans-serif;
  font-size: 1.2em;
  position:static; 
  top:0;
  left:0;
  bottom:20px; 
  right:0; 
  background:#ffffff;
  padding:10px;
  text-align: left;
  width:100%;
  }

#printheader{    Z-INDEX: 6;    BACKGROUND: url(../images/OSCPA-logo.jpg) #ffffff no-repeat;    LEFT: 0px;    WIDTH: 215px;    POSITION: absolute;    TOP: 20px;    HEIGHT: 137px;    cursor: hand;
}

H1 { font-size: 1.5em; font-weight:bolder; }

.heading { font-size: 1.5em; font-weight:bolder; }

H3 { font-size: 1.2em; }

.subheading { font-size: 1.2em; }

.noprint
{
	display:none;
}

table
{
	font-size:1em;
    text-align:left;}

A {    TEXT-DECORATION: none;}A:hover{        TEXT-DECORATION: underline;}A:visited{	COLOR: purple;}A:link{    COLOR: blue;}
.headerimage
{
  display:none;
}

#upleft{	display:none;
}

#upcenter{	display:none;
}

#topnav{	display:none;
}

#topnav a:link, #topnav a:visited {display:none;}

#search{	display:none;
}
.vcenter{	vertical-align: middle}.menu 
{
	display:none;
}

/* for internet explorer */
* html .menu {display:none;}

.menu div {display:none;}

.menu .tabsteelblueleft {display:none}
.menu .tabsteelbluecenter {display:none}
.menu .tabsteelblueright {display:none}

.menu .tabgoldleft {display:none}
.menu .tabgoldcenter {display:none}
.menu .tabgoldright {display:none}

.menu .taboliveleft {display:none}
.menu .tabolivecenter {display:none}
.menu .taboliveright {display:none}

.menu .tabtealleft {display:none}
.menu .tabtealcenter {display:none}
.menu .tabtealright {display:none}

.menu .tabpurpleleft {display:none}
.menu .tabpurplecenter {display:none}
.menu .tabpurpleright {display:none}

.menu .tabroseleft {display:none}
.menu .tabrosecenter {display:none}
.menu .tabroseright {display:none}

.menu .tabtanleft {display:none}
.menu .tabtancenter {display:none}
.menu .tabtanright {display:none}

.menu .tabclayleft {display:none}
.menu .tabclaycenter {display:none}
.menu .tabclayright {display:none}

.menu .tablighttealleft {display:none}
.menu .tablighttealcenter {display:none}
.menu .tablighttealright {display:none}

.menu .tabgreenleft {display:none}
.menu .tabgreencenter {display:none}
.menu .tabgreenright {display:none}

.menu .taborangeleft {display:none}
.menu .taborangecenter {display:none}
.menu .taborangeright {display:none}

.menu a, .menu a:visited {display:none}
.menu a:hover {display:none}
.menu span {display:none}
.menu a:hover span {display:none}

.menubar
{
	display:none;
}

.menubar a {display:none}
.menubar a:visited {display:none}

#menusub
{
	display:none;
}

#header
{
	display:none;
}


/* controlling number of columns */

.roundedtable .hctr .rthead8 {display:none}
.roundedtable .rthead10 {display:none}

.columnone 
{
	display:none;
}

.column2and3 {
width:98%;
float:left;
background:#ffffff;
padding-bottom:10px;
	}	

.columntwo {
width:54%;
float:left;
background:#ffffff;
padding-bottom:10px;
margin-right:5px;
	}
	
.columnthree {
float:left;
background:#ffffff;
padding-bottom:10px;
	}	

.column2-50 {
width:49%;
float:left;
background:#ffffff;
padding-bottom:10px;
	}
	
.column3-50 {
width:50%;
float:left;
background:#ffffff;
padding-bottom:10px;
	}	

.column2-40 {
width:31%;
float:left;
background:#ffffff;
padding-bottom:10px;
	}
	
.column3-60 {
width:47%;
float:left;
background:#ffffff;
padding-bottom:10px;
	}

#copyright{POSITION: static;float:left;width:100%;FONT-SIZE: 10px;COLOR: black;BACKGROUND: #ffffff;PADDING-BOTTOM: 10px;}
/* from 2005 Web site */

.helpbox{	width:100px;	padding:5px;	margin:5px;	border-style:groove;}#floatright{	float:right;
	margin: 0 0 0 10px;
}

#floatrighthead{	font-weight: bold;	font-size: 1.5em;    LINE-HEIGHT: normal;	color: black;	text-align:center;}#floatrightsubhead{	font-weight: bold;	font-size: 15px;    LINE-HEIGHT: normal;	color: #9C3031;		text-align:center;}#important{	color: Red;}

.important{	font-weight: bold;	font-size: 15px;    LINE-HEIGHT: normal;	color: red;}

.dropcap
{
	font-size:30px;
	font-weight:bolder; 
}

/*
#footer {
  position:absolute; 
  bottom:0; 
  left:0;
  width:100%; 
  height:45px; 
  overflow:auto; 
  text-align:center; 
  background:#FFFFFF;
  border-top:5px solid #24315A;
  }
* html #footer {height:50px;}
*/
.bulletinbox{	padding:5px;
	background:#dcdcdc;
	border:4px groove #a9a9a9;
}.blackbox{	border: solid thin black;	padding: 5px;	background-color:White;	background:White;}.borderboxright{	padding:5px;
	background:#dcdcdc;
	float:right;
	margin: 0 0 10px 10px;
	border:4px groove #a9a9a9;
}.borderboxhead{	font-weight: bold;	font-size: 1.2em;    LINE-HEIGHT: normal;	color: black;	text-align:center;}.borderboxsubhead{	font-weight: bold;	font-size: 15px;    LINE-HEIGHT: normal;	color: #9C3031;		text-align:center;}.floatright{	float:right;
	margin: 0 0 10px 10px;
}
.floatrighthead{	font-weight: bold;	font-size: 1.5em;    LINE-HEIGHT: normal;	color: black;	text-align:center;}.floatrightsubhead{	font-weight: bold;	font-size: 15px;    LINE-HEIGHT: normal;	color: #9C3031;		text-align:center;}.bulletinbox{	padding:5px;
	margin:0 10px 0 10px;
}#floatright350{	float:right;
	width:350px;
	margin: 10px;
}

#cpe{	border: solid thin black;	padding: 5px;	margin: 6px;}.surveytable{	background-color: #00CCCC;	border-width: medium;	border-style: ridge;	border-color: #00CCCC;		font-size: 9px;	width: 150px;	margin: 0 0 10px 10px;}#survfloatright{	float:right;
	position: relative;	top: 40;	margin-bottom: 40;}.surveyht{	height: 10px;}.surveyhead{	font-size: 14px;	color: White;	background-color: Teal;}.surveyques{	font-size: 12px;	font-weight: bold;}#survother{	line-height: 7pt;	font-size: 8pt;}#survfloatleft{	float:left;
	position: relative;	top: 40;	margin-bottom: 40;	margin-right: 40;}#footreg{		display:none;}